1. eukaryotic cell

2. eukaryotic protein

3. eukaryotic membrane

4. eukaryotic organelle

5. eukaryotic gene

6. eukaryotic transcription

7. eukaryotic translation

8. eukaryotic cell division

双语例句:

1. Eukaryotes are the most complex organisms on Earth, with a diverse range of cell types and functions.

2. The eukaryotic membrane is a complex structure that allows cells to regulate their internal environment.

3. Eukaryotic organelles play crucial roles in cellular metabolism and energy production.

4. Eukaryotic transcription and translation are fundamental processes that generate proteins essential for life.

5. Eukaryotic cell division is a complex process that ensures the continued growth and reproduction of cells.

6. Eukaryotic genes encode proteins that perform a wide range of functions in cells and organisms.

7. The eukaryotic cell is a highly organized and complex system that requires precise regulation for proper function.
